Educational Toys
Educational toys are designed to stimulate a child’s mind while providing fun and engagement. For 5-year-old boys, these toys can enhance their learning experiences in various subjects, including math, science, and language.
- STEM Kits: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ics (STEM) kits are excellent for fostering a love for learning. Kits that allow children to build simple machines or conduct safe experiments can spark interest in these fields. Brands like LEGO Education and Snap Circuits offer age-appropriate kits that encourage problem-solving and critical thinking.
- Learning Tablets: Tablets designed for young children, such as the Amazon Fire Kids Edition, come pre-loaded with educational apps, games, and e-books. These devices can help improve literacy and numeracy skills while providing entertainment.
- Puzzle Games: Puzzles that challenge a child’s cognitive abilities are fantastic gifts. Look for puzzles that feature numbers, letters, or even simple math problems. They help develop problem-solving skills and hand-eye coordination.
Outdoor Activities
Outdoor play is essential for the physical development of children. Gifts that encourage outdoor activities can help a 5-year-old boy stay active and healthy.

- Bicycles: A balance bike or a small bicycle can be a perfect gift for a 5-year-old. Riding helps develop balance, coordination, and confidence. Look for bikes with adjustable seats and training wheels for beginners.
- Sports Equipment: Items like soccer balls, basketballs, or baseball gloves can introduce children to various sports. Engaging in sports teaches teamwork, discipline, and physical fitness.
- Outdoor Adventure Kits: Sets that include items like a magnifying glass, binoculars, and a bug-catching kit can inspire a love for nature. These kits encourage exploration and curiosity about the environment.

Building and Construction Toys
Building and construction toys are excellent for developing fine motor skills and spatial reasoning. They encourage creativity and imaginative play.
- LEGO Sets: LEGO sets designed for younger children, like LEGO Duplo, are perfect for 5-year-olds. These larger blocks are easier to handle and can be used to create various structures, enhancing creativity and fine motor skills.
- Magnetic Building Blocks: Sets like Magformers or Tegu blocks are great for encouraging creativity and engineering skills. These magnetic pieces can be easily connected and disconnected, allowing for endless construction possibilities.
- Wooden Building Sets: Traditional wooden blocks or construction sets, such as Kapla or Bauspiel, can provide hours of open-ended play. They are durable and encourage imaginative play.
Imaginative Play
Imaginative play is crucial for developing social skills and creativity. Gifts that encourage role-playing and storytelling can be very beneficial.
- Costumes and Dress-Up Sets: Costumes that allow children to dress up as their favorite characters or professions can inspire imaginative play. Whether it’s a superhero, pirate, or firefighter, these costumes can enhance storytelling and role-playing.
- Play Sets: Playsets that mimic real-life scenarios, such as kitchen sets, tool sets, or doctor kits, can be incredibly engaging. These sets encourage children to role-play and explore different professions and situations.
- Action Figures and Dolls: Action figures from popular franchises or dolls can inspire imaginative play. Children can create their own stories and adventures with these characters, enhancing their creativity and social skills.
Books and Storytelling
Books are a timeless gift that can foster a love for reading from an early age. They also help develop language skills and imagination.
- Picture Books: Engaging picture books with colorful illustrations and relatable stories are perfect for 5-year-olds. Titles like “The Very Hungry Caterpillar” by Eric Carle or “Where the Wild Things Are” by Maurice Sendak are classics that children love.
- Interactive Books: Books that include flaps, textures, or sound can make reading more interactive and fun. These types of books engage children and keep their attention longer.
- Storytelling Kits: Kits that include storycards or puppets can encourage children to create their own stories. This type of gift fosters creativity and language development.
